DQN Named Dimensions Registry
Invariant 8 enforcement. Every semantic index has a named constant. Raw indices ([0], [6], [23]) appear ONLY at definition sites. Consumer code always uses the named constant.
State vector offsets
Defined in crates/ml/src/cuda_pipeline/state_layout.cuh and mirrored in Rust via ml-core::state_layout.

Portfolio state slots (ps[0..PS_STRIDE=38))
Defined in crates/ml/src/cuda_pipeline/state_layout.cuh (PS_* constants).
Consumer code uses the named constants; raw ps[N] access outside definition
sites is a lint violation (Invariant 8). Slots 3-6 and 22 also carry legacy
named aliases in experience_kernels.cu (DSR_A_SLOT etc.) retained for
in-file use; PS_* names are the canonical cross-file form.

Branch FC input strides (direction- vs OFI-conditioned)
The four branch FC heads (w_b{0,1,2,3}fc) and their gate twins
(w_gate_{0,1,2,3}) have different input strides depending on what each
branch concatenates onto the trunk activation:
| Branch (d) |
Constant role |
Input stride |
Conditioning |
| 0 (Direction) |
trunk only |
shared_h2 |
none |
| 1 (Magnitude) |
mag_concat |
shared_h2 + branch_0_size |
direction-conditioned (concat of h_s2 + per-direction Q values, 4 in production) |
| 2 (Order) |
ord_concat |
shared_h2 + 3 |
OFI-conditioned (concat of vsn_masked + 3 OFI features) |
| 3 (Urgency) |
urg_concat |
shared_h2 + 3 |
OFI-conditioned (concat of vsn_masked + 3 OFI features) |
Invariant (off-by-one trap). The +3 constant is overloaded: in the OFI
branches it's a literal (3 features per branch from concat_ofi_features), but
in the magnitude branch it must derive from branch_0_size (since 4-direction
S/H/L/F was added). Buffers, weight tensors, GEMM cache shapes, accumulator
strides, and dX backward dims all share this contract — see commit fixing
mag_concat_qdir OOB (compute-sanitizer caught 1679 errors). Direction-conditioned
sites: w_b1fc, w_gate_1, mag_concat_buf, d_mag_concat_buf. OFI-conditioned
sites: w_b{2,3}fc, w_gate_{2,3}, {ord,urg}_concat_buf,
d_{ord,urg}_concat_buf.
